RESEARCH INTERESTS

My research work is focused on understanding Chemical Warfare Agents (CWAs), their precursors, degradation products, and chemistry for identification using various advanced instrumental techniques. As part of the OPCW mission, my work contributes to implementing the provisions of the Chemical Weapons Convention (CWC) with the vision of achieving a world free of chemical weapons and their threat, where chemistry is used for peace, progress, and prosperity.

In agriculture and household applications, pesticides play a critical role with both advantages and environmental/health concerns. My research includes technical analysis of pesticides, formulation studies, residue and impurity analysis for regulatory control, safe usage, and promotion of bio-botanical pesticides as futuristic alternatives.

My work emphasizes:

  1. CWA analysis
  2. Pesticide and pesticide residue analysis using advanced extraction and instrumental techniques across multiple matrices
  3. Development and validation of analytical methods as per international guidelines
  4. Maintaining laboratory accreditations such as NABL, OPCW, and GLP

KEY TECHNICAL & RESEARCH EXPERTISE

  1. OPCW proficiency testing (PT) sample preparation and qualitative analysis of CWC-related chemicals from soil, water, organic matrices, metal sheets, sanitizers, etc., using GC (NPD, FPD), GC-MS
  2. Derivatization of CWC-related chemicals (silylation, methylation, thiolation)
  3. Extraction of complex matrices using silica SAX/SCX clean-up
  4. Synthesis of CWC precursors, degradation products, and by-products
  5. Identification and confirmation of compounds using GC, LC, GC-MS, LC-MS
  6. Study Director / Deputy Study Director / Study Personnel in GLP studies
  7. SOP preparation for physico-chemical parameters, multiresidue analysis, and A.I. content as per OECD / CIPAC / WHO / FAO / SANTE guidelines
  8. Study plan, study schedule, study report preparation and QA compliance
  9. Deputy Quality Manager (NABL), Analytical Division, IPFT
  10. Method development and validation using LC-MS/MS, LC-QTOF (HRMS), GC-MS/MS
  11. Internal calibration and maintenance of UV, FTIR, GC, HPLC, GC-MS, LC-MS/MS, LC-QTOF and other instruments
  12. Multi-residue pesticide analysis in food, grains, vegetables, soil, and water
  13. Training of professionals from Indian and international pesticide industries
  14. Development of synthetic and bio-pesticide formulations (gel, microemulsion, EC, nano-formulations) and bio-efficacy studies
  15. Organic synthesis, purification, and structural elucidation using PREP-HPLC, LC-QTOF-MS, FTIR, NMR, UV
  16. Process development of agrochemicals, intermediates, and pharmaceutical intermediates
